Republican Lisa Demuth of Cold Spring is the new Speaker of the Minnesota House of Representatives.
Demuth’s installation came after 66 DFL representatives dropped their boycott of the chamber for the first time this session — which finally brought the room to quorum, or the required number of people to conduct business.
“Even knowing that there’s some frustration and some anger, it’s important that we move forward without any type of retaliatory behavior,” Demuth told MPR News host Cathy Wurzer.
“We have to find a pathway through.”
Under a new power-sharing deal, Demuth will be speaker at least through next year.
Speaker Lisa Demuth spoke with Wurzer Friday morning about her priorities and vision for the House.
